A wedding at The Zuri White Sands Goa, the beachfront resort at Varca in South Goa, typically runs Rs 30 lakh to Rs 1.5 crore all-in for 150 to 600 guests across 2 to 3 days. Per-plate food and beverage sits at Rs 3,000 to Rs 6,000. A 300-guest, 3-event celebration usually lands near Rs 55 lakh to Rs 1.1 crore.

The Zuri White Sands is a large beachfront resort at Varca in South Goa, set on a long stretch of white-sand beach with beach, lawn and poolside venues. Budget roughly Rs 30 lakh to Rs 50 lakh for 150 guests, Rs 55 lakh to Rs 1.1 crore for 300 guests, and Rs 90 lakh to Rs 1.5 crore for 600 guests across a 2 to 3 day celebration. Per-plate food and beverage, at Rs 3,000 to Rs 6,000 a head, is the single largest line and moves the total more than any other cost as guest numbers rise.
What makes The Zuri White Sands Goa special for weddings
The Zuri White Sands sits at Varca in South Goa, right on one of the longest, quietest white-sand beaches in the state. South Goa is calmer and more resort-led than the busy, party-driven north, which suits couples who want a private, unhurried destination wedding. The resort offers beach and lawn venues for ceremonies and receptions, one of the largest free-form swimming pools in Goa for poolside functions, manicured lawns, a full-service spa, an in-house casino for guest entertainment, and extensive rooms and villas. Guests can stay, celebrate and unwind in one place, which is exactly what a multi-day beach wedding needs. The white-sand backdrop and sea does much of the decor work on its own.
Spaces and capacities at The Zuri White Sands Goa
The resort spreads several distinct wedding spaces across its beachfront estate, so each function can have its own setting.
- Beachfront lawn: Open green lawns opening onto the white-sand beach, ideal for the wedding ceremony, pheras and large evening receptions under the sky.
- Poolside area: The large free-form pool, one of Goa’s biggest, frames relaxed sundowner cocktails, welcome parties and daytime sangeet setups.
- Banquet halls: Multiple air-conditioned indoor banquet halls act as the reliable weather-proof backup and host seated dinners, mehndi and pre-wedding functions.
- Pre-function and foyer areas: Covered foyers and pre-function spaces handle registration, welcome drinks, high tea and cocktail hour before guests move into the main venue.
- Rooms and villas: A large inventory of rooms and villas houses the wedding party and guests on-site, so the whole celebration stays within the resort.
Indoor and outdoor capacities
Beach and lawn venues carry the largest crowds and comfortably host 300 to 600 guests for an open-air ceremony or reception, while the indoor banquet halls suit seated functions of roughly 150 to 400 depending on the hall and layout. A 300-guest wedding typically uses the beachfront lawn for the pheras and main reception, the poolside for a sundowner, and a banquet hall for the mehndi or a seated dinner. Because the marquee functions are outdoors on sand and grass, weather matters: the dry October to March window is safest, and any monsoon-season date needs a firm covered backup plan.

The Zuri White Sands Goa wedding cost breakdown (2026)
Venue and hall hire
The Zuri, like most Goa resorts, rarely charges a flat venue rent. Space is bundled into a package built on per-plate food and beverage plus a minimum room-night block, with a separate setup charge for beach and lawn functions to cover staging, flooring and lighting on sand. For a 300-guest, multi-day wedding expect a room block of roughly 60 to 120 rooms across the dates. The room block, not a hall fee, is the real fixed cost of booking the resort.
Catering and per-plate
Food and beverage is the largest single line. At Rs 3,000 to Rs 6,000 per plate, catering for 300 guests across three events runs roughly Rs 20 lakh to Rs 45 lakh, before premium bar packages push it higher. The kitchen spans multi-cuisine menus, north Indian, pan-Asian and continental, alongside fresh Goan seafood that most couples make the centrepiece of at least one function. Live counters, a seafood shack theme and premium alcohol are the main upgrades that move this number.
Decor and production
Beach and lawn decor at The Zuri typically runs Rs 8 lakh to Rs 30 lakh, and it is the most discretionary line in the budget. The white-sand beach and sea backdrop already do a great deal of the visual work, so a restrained floral and lighting scheme reads as expensive. Couples who bring in elaborate imported florals, custom mandap builds, multiple themed setups and heavy production can push decor well past Rs 40 lakh across a three-event wedding.
Photography, film and entertainment
A full photography and cinematography team, covering all events across two to three days with candid, traditional and drone coverage, typically runs Rs 4 lakh to Rs 15 lakh. Entertainment, a DJ, live band, sundowner act or celebrity performer, adds another Rs 3 lakh to Rs 20 lakh depending on the name. Booked together, photo, film and entertainment commonly land in the Rs 8 lakh to Rs 30 lakh band for a 300-guest celebration.
Hospitality, room block and taxes
Because this is a destination wedding, most guests stay on-site, so hospitality, rooms, airport transfers, welcome hampers and local logistics, combines into one large line. Room-nights for a 60 to 120 room block across the dates, plus Dabolim airport transfers and on-ground coordination, commonly run Rs 15 lakh to Rs 40 lakh for a 300-guest wedding. Keeping everyone inside the resort simplifies logistics but makes the room block the anchor of the whole budget.
Sample budget: 300-guest wedding at The Zuri White Sands Goa (2026)
| Line item | Range |
|---|---|
| Food and beverage, 300 guests, 3 events | Rs 20 lakh to Rs 45 lakh |
| Room block and hospitality | Rs 15 lakh to Rs 40 lakh |
| Decor and production | Rs 8 lakh to Rs 30 lakh |
| Photography, film and entertainment | Rs 8 lakh to Rs 30 lakh |
| Setup charges, coordination and buffer | Rs 4 lakh to Rs 15 lakh |
| Total | Rs 55 lakh-1.1 crore |
These bands assume a 300-guest, 3-event wedding across two to three days, with most guests housed on-site. The spread between Rs 55 lakh and Rs 1.1 crore is driven mainly by the bar package, the decor ambition and how many premium rooms and villas the block uses. A leaner guest list, simpler decor and a shoulder-season date sit at the lower end.
What the The Zuri White Sands Goa quote covers and what costs extra
A Zuri wedding package usually bundles the venue space, banquet setup, in-house catering and service staff, basic table and stage setup, and the contracted room block. It does not typically include decor and florals, photography and cinematography, entertainment and DJs, mandap and stage design, premium bar upgrades beyond the base package, or guest airport transfers. These are quoted separately and are where the budget genuinely flexes, so confirm exactly what the per-plate rate and package cover before comparing quotes across resorts.
What pushes a The Zuri White Sands Goa wedding cost up or down
Guest count and per-plate together move the total more than anything else, since food and beverage scales directly with heads. The room block is the second big lever: more rooms and more villa or sea-view upgrades raise the floor quickly. Season matters, with peak October to March dates commanding the top rates. After that, the swing comes from the bar package, decor ambition, number of events, and whether you bring marquee entertainment. Trimming the guest list and simplifying decor are the fastest ways to bring the number down.
Best season and dates to book The Zuri White Sands Goa
Goa’s wedding season runs October to March, the dry, pleasant window when beach and lawn functions are safest and demand and rates peak, especially around December and the New Year. April and May are hotter and quieter, and can carry softer shoulder-season rates. The June to September monsoon is generally avoided for outdoor beach functions because of rain, though indoor banquets remain workable and pricing is at its lowest. For a peak-season Saturday, book eight to twelve months ahead to secure the resort, your dates and the room block.
Guest experience, stay and getting there
The Zuri White Sands is at Varca in South Goa, on a long beachfront roughly 60 to 75 minutes from Dabolim (Goa’s original airport), which is the convenient gateway for this resort. The newer Mopa airport in the far north is considerably further, closer to two hours or more by road. Because the resort holds extensive rooms and villas, most guests stay on-site, which keeps a destination wedding simple: functions, stays and meals sit in one place. Plan airport transfers and coordinate arrival windows, since guests fly in from multiple cities.

Planning timeline for a The Zuri White Sands Goa wedding
A destination beach wedding at The Zuri rewards an early start, so lock the big pieces well ahead.
- 9 to 12 months ahead: Lock the date and hold your main space at The Zuri White Sands Goa, and agree the per-function minimum guarantee or buyout terms so the booking is secure.
- 6 to 8 months ahead: Finalise the guest list and the room block, shortlist decor, production and entertainment teams, and confirm the function plan across your events.
- 4 to 5 months ahead: Run the menu tasting, lock catering covers and the beverage package, and confirm photography, film and any artists.
- 2 to 3 months ahead: Sign off decor and production designs, the event flow, guest hospitality and transport, and the hair-and-makeup schedule.
- 1 month ahead: Confirm final guaranteed covers, the detailed run sheet, vendor call times and the rooming list with the The Zuri White Sands Goa team.
- Week of the wedding: On-site setup, sound and light checks, a rehearsal where needed and a final walkthrough with the venue and all vendors.

Alternatives in the region
If you are comparing across Goa, the main luxury beach and resort alternatives are The St. Regis Goa, W Goa, Taj Cidade de Goa, The Leela Goa, Grand Hyatt Goa, Park Hyatt Goa, ITC Grand Goa and Alila Diwa Goa. Broadly, North Goa resorts sit closer to the nightlife and Mopa airport, while South Goa options like The Zuri, The Leela and Alila Diwa are quieter, greener and more private. Across the state, expect a similar all-in band of Rs 30 lakh to well over Rs 1.5 crore depending on the property and guest count.
